Looking Back – April 18

2007

Gov. Mitch Daniels and Maj. Gen. R. Martin Umbarger announced the Army planned to transform Muscatatuck Urban Training Center into a war-torn city to be used for military training, at a cost of $100 million.

1992

A twin-engine plane carrying seven employees of a north Carolina business landed safely at Columbus Municipal Airport after one of the plane’s engines faltered.

1967

Operations were back to normal at the Como Plastics plant here following a brief wildcat strike which resulted in the discharge of several workers.
